Obituary

Funeral services for Dennis Jay Mower, Sr., 72, of Wills Point, are scheduled for 2:00 p.m. Wednesday, August 24, 2016, at Allan Fuller Funeral Home Chapel in Wills Point with Mr. Oran Helm officiating. Interment will follow at Mower's Peaceful Garden north of Wills Point.

He passed away early Thursday morning, August 18, 2016, in Grand Saline.

Dennis was born August 2, 1944, in Pocatello, Idaho, the son of Robert & Mildred Mower. He was raised in Pocatello and graduated from Pocatello High School. On October 28, 1978, he married Nancy Kelly in Vancouver, Washington. Dennis was self-employed contractor in the construction business, retiring in 2013. Prior to moving to Wills Point twenty years ago he lived in Vancouver. He was of the Mormon faith.

Preceded in death by his parents, Robert & Mildred Mower; daughter, Dodie Carlson; brother, Eldon Wayne Mower and three sisters, Ruth Lundquist, Edith Mower and Arlene King.

Dennis is survived by his wife, Nancy Mower, of Wills Point; son, Dennis Jay Mower, Jr. & wife, Sarah, of Washington; three daughters, Peggy Mower, of Edgewood, Tami Mower and Christine Elliott; two brothers, Robert Mower, of Washington and Ronald Mower, of Idaho; two sisters, Lovania Mower, of Idaho and Charlotte Mower, of Idaho; numerous grandchildren and great-grandchildren; nieces, nephews and other relatives.

Family will receive friends at the funeral home Tuesday evening from 5:00 – 7:00 p.m.
